Start with Real-Life Needs


Pet owners have clear needs. They want help keeping track of feeding times, vet visits, grooming, walks, and training. A good app should support all these daily tasks in a simple way.


Instead of packing in too many options, pet startups should focus on a few key features that work well. Clear reminders, easy-to-use calendars, and health record tracking are a great starting point. When people feel that the app helps them manage their pet better, they are more likely to use it again and again.



Make Information Easy to Access


Pet care often includes a lot of details. Vaccine dates, food habits, grooming plans, and medicine can be hard to remember. An app that stores this information in a clean and simple format adds a lot of value.


For example, if a pet needs medicine every evening for five days, an alert system with a checkbox for each day helps the owner stay on track. If the pet needs a checkup every six months, the app can remind the user at the right time.



Allow Sharing Between Family Members


In many homes, more than one person helps take care of the pet. A strong app should support shared accounts or team access. This way, all caregivers know what has already been done—whether the pet was fed, walked, or given medication.


Sharing updates in real time builds teamwork and avoids mistakes. This kind of feature shows that the app fits real family life, which builds trust.

Add Local Support Services


Another way pet startups can build loyalty is by offering easy access to nearby services. This can include:




  • Vets and clinics

  • Pet stores

  • Trainers

  • Grooming salons

  • Dog walking or sitting services


With mobile app development tools, it's possible to show results based on the user’s area. People appreciate this kind of local support—it saves time and shows that the app understands their daily needs.



Keep It Simple and Bug-Free


Even with great features, users won’t stay if the app is slow, full of bugs, or hard to use. Pet startups need to focus on smooth user flow. This means simple menus, fast loading, and clear buttons.


Mobile app development should include testing on different phones to make sure everything works well. Updates should be regular, and customer support should be easy to reach.
